New emergency sirens

Emergency SirenThis week, the City replaced emergency sirens with two new sirens. The City was unable to depend reliably on the former sirens. When sirens are tested on the first Tuesday of the month, residents will now hear a much more pleasant sound. Residents will now hear the Westminster Chimes. In an emergency, residents will hear the typical sirens. The new sirens also have voice capabilities.

 

According to Mayor Flannigan, these updated sirens have been in the works for more than three years. The funding includes 80% from a State Emergency Management Agency (SEMA) grant and the City budgeted for the remaining 20%.
